Engineering and Computing Career Fair set for Feb. 13


LAWRENCE — More than 120 companies and agencies will be on hand at the Spring Engineering & Computing Career Fair, which is set for noon-4 p.m. Thursday, Feb. 13, at the Kansas Union.

The event is an opportunity for University of Kansas engineering students to make connections for that dream job or ideal internship. Students can gather information about a wide variety of companies, network with industry representatives, and learn about potential internship and employment opportunities. Students should review the complete list of employers and study those of interest prior to arrival. Students should dress professionally and bring multiple copies of their resume to share with prospective employers. The career fair is open to all KU students, but employers will primarily focus on making connections with students in engineering, computing and the hard sciences.

The night before the career fair, the Engineering Career Center will host Board Game Night. The event begins at 5:30 p.m. in LEEP2, Room G411. This networking event, open to all students, provides an opportunity to visit with employers, play some board games and enjoy some pizza.
